Definitions

  • the present invention relates to a lock, in particular a retrofittable Lock for doors, windows or the like, with a lock cylinder for actuating a lock bolt.
  • the invention relates in particular cylinder protection, i.e. a protection device for locking cylinders of door locks as well as additional door locks, e.g. one Tank latch lock.
  • Another The object of the invention is to propose a lock with cylinder protection, which has a compact shape, made from as few as possible Parts exist and therefore easy to assemble and inexpensive to manufacture is.
  • Such a lock with a cylinder protection according to the present invention has the advantage that the protective pot has direct access from the Prevents the outside of the door on the lock cylinder and no attack surface for lifting or removing the protective pot. Thereby will provide a higher level of security against violent interference, in particular reached against pulling or twisting the locking cylinder.
  • the lock according to the invention consists of proportionately a few parts that are assembled before assembly and as an assembly with a compact shape can be installed. This makes the lock easy to assemble and inexpensive to manufacture.
  • the lock with cylinder protection is on the cylinder housing Retaining cuff provided.
  • the retaining collar on the cylinder housing can shape have a circumferential groove in which to be plugged onto the cylinder housing Protective pot is pressed in at least in certain areas. To this The protective pot is at least partially over the cylinder housing everted, engaging in the retaining collar via indentations and so is firmly connected to the cylinder housing.
  • the protective pot is pressed in at least at one point, preferably each at four diametrically opposite points. Is next to it it is also possible to have a continuous peripheral edge in the protective pot to press in, which engages in the retaining collar on the cylinder housing. alternative the free peripheral edge of the protective pot can preferably are continuously flanged inwards in order to To intervene. This makes the protective pot particularly good, however nevertheless fixed in a simple manner on the cylinder housing and against prying off and peeling secured. It is advantageous if the cylinder housing and the protective pot has a substantially cylindrical shape exhibit.
  • the protective pot is designed in such a way that the depressions or the continuous peripheral edge in the protective pot over a radial external tools can be inserted.
  • the Protective pot and the cylinder housing preferably before pressing in painted, with paint flaking at the press points on the Protective pot can be repaired after the press-in process.
  • the front of the protective pot is for the one to be inserted into the locking cylinder Key provided a key opening and there in particular eccentrically arranged.
  • Cylinder housing or at least one positioning bar on the protective pot provided that in a corresponding recess in the other Part engages to rotate the protective pot with respect to the cylinder housing align and prevent relative rotation.
  • the positioning web (s) are designed so that when the protective pot is loaded give way or break off by a certain torque and thus allow rotation of the protective pot with respect to the cylinder housing.
  • the positioning webs are practical as predetermined breaking points designed to prevent twisting of the protective pot the lock cylinder is also rotated by means of a demolition tool becomes. The protective pot can then be freely facing the cylinder housing be twisted and does not exert any noteworthy effect on the locking cylinder Torque more.
  • the security against burglary of the lock according to the invention can still be increase further if the key opening for the key to be inserted into the locking cylinder through a pull-out protective disk is at least partially covered, with the anti-drag screen in the key opening of the protective pot, preferably by a the bearing plate inserted in the protective pot is held in position.
  • the Anti-pull disk has a recess for the lock cylinder key to be inserted and is preferably rotatably mounted.
  • the Anti-pulling disc makes it difficult to insert demolition tools into the lock cylinder and is only due to its rotatable bearing difficult to overcome with a drilling tool.
  • the cylinder housing can Die casting process from an easily machinable metal, in particular be made of die-cast zinc or plastic. Because the bearing plate it does not have to be designed for large loads, it can also be preferred made of die-cast zinc or plastic.
  • the protective pot and the anti-pulling screen as exposed and therefore safety-relevant parts made of particularly resistant Material, preferably made of surface hardened metal are. The protective pot should not be fully hardened, otherwise pressing the protective pot in some areas to create the depressions would be difficult.
  • the cylinder housing with the attached protective pot in one prepared hole in the door leaf from one side and then from the other side a rosette is placed over the Protective pot and the cylinder housing pushed over.
  • the rosette has one Shaft with which it can be steplessly placed over the protective pot and the cylinder housing can be slipped on, so that they have different door dimensions is adjustable.
  • the cylinder housing and / or the protective pot preferably has at least a claw, through which the slipped over the protective pot Rosette is held. It is advantageous if the cylinder housing evenly distributed around its circumference with a number of claws is provided for the rosette.
  • the rosette can be on the inside of the shaft with depressions running in the circumferential direction or Corrugations to be provided in cooperation with the claws a gradual displacement of the rosette on the cylinder housing or on the protective pot. In this way there are no other fasteners more needed for the rosette that gives the visual impression from the outside.
  • the holding claws also ensures that between the rosette and the cylinder housing do not require an exact fit is. Therefore, the manufacture of the cylinder housing and the protective pot done with larger tolerances, which affects manufacturing costs has a favorable effect. Because the rosette is not exposed to heavy loads is and does not fulfill a safety-relevant function, it can be made of a plastic, which preferably has a metallic appearance having.
  • FIG. 1 is an embodiment of a lock according to the present Invention with its individual components in an exploded view shown.
  • the lock according to the Invention a cylinder housing 1 with a substantially cylindrical Form that has an axially continuous opening 18 for receiving a in Fig. 1 not shown locking cylinder.
  • On the cylinder housing 1 are a circumferential circumferential groove as a retaining collar 2 and axially arranged Positioning webs 8 are formed.
  • a protective pot 5 is also substantially cylindrical shape placed so that he the cylinder housing 1st at least partially surrounds.
  • At the free edge of the protective pot 5 is one Recess 6 provided in which the positioning webs 8 on the cylinder housing 1 intervene to the protective pot 5 opposite the cylinder housing 1 to be rotatory in a certain position. This alignment is necessary because the protective pot 5 in its end face for the an eccentrically arranged key to be inserted into the locking cylinder 1 - Has key opening, not shown in the drawing, with the position of the locking cylinder in the cylinder housing 1 in cover must be brought.
  • the Protection pot 5 pressed in at least in some areas near its free end. In this way, wells 7 are created, which in the Engage the retaining collar 2 and thus the protective pot 5 on the cylinder housing 1 fix.
  • the protective pot 5 is pressed in, for example Via a tool acting radially from the outside, preferably on four diametrically opposite points 7.
  • you can the free circumferential edge of the protective pot 5 is also preferably continuous be flanged inwards to engage in the retaining collar 2.
  • the positioning webs engaging in the recess 6 on the protective pot 5 8 are preferably designed such that they are at a certain Give up or abort the torsional load of the protective pot 5 and thus due to the essentially cylindrical shape of the protective pot 5 a rotational movement of the two parts 1 with respect to the cylinder housing 1, 5 allow relative to each other.
  • the lock according to the Invention is the key opening provided in the protective pot 5 through a Anti-drag disk 4 at least partially covered by a bearing plate 3 is held in position.
  • the anti-pull washer 4 introduced together with the bearing plate 3 in the protective pot 5 before this is arranged on the cylinder housing 1.
  • the anti-drag screen 4 has a recess 17 for the one to be inserted into the locking cylinder Key on and is preferably rotatable in the bearing plate 3rd stored.
  • the anti-pull disk 4 makes it difficult to insert Demolition tools in the lock cylinder and can because of it rotatable bearings are difficult to penetrate by a drill.
  • a rosette 10 are put on.
  • the rosette 10 is held by holding claws 9, which are preferably on the cylinder housing 1 are evenly distributed around the entire circumference.
  • the holding claws 9 can also be provided on the protective pot 5 his.
  • the rosette 10 is not subjected to any special loads and can therefore be made of a plastic, which is preferably a metallic Appearance.
  • the protective pot 5 and the pull-out protective disk are fulfilled 4 a safety-relevant function and are therefore advantageously made of particularly resistant material, preferred made of surface hardened metal.
  • the protective pot 5 should not be completely hardened, as this will make it difficult to deform in some areas would.
  • the cylinder housing 1 and the bearing plate 3 can inexpensive die-cast zinc or made of plastic.
  • FIGS. 2 and 3 for a Lock according to the invention is an armored bolt lock, that can be retrofitted to doors or gates.
  • Fig. 2 shows a perspective view from below of such an armored bolt lock, in which a lock is used according to the present invention is.
  • Fig. 2 shows the back of the bolt lock, that of the to be secured Side of the door is facing.
  • 3 is a perspective view from above on the armored bolt lock of Fig. 2 and thus shows the visible side of the bolt lock after assembly. 2 and 3 it can be seen that the cylinder housing 1 and the protective pot 5th in the installed state with the put on rosette 10 in a prepared Hole in the door leaf (not shown) are housed.
  • the lock cylinder 15 is actuated, the two opposite Lock bolt 11 drives.
  • the lock bolts 11 each moved laterally by bolt receptacles 12, which have fasteners 13 attached to the door frame, frame or wall are.
